Son Heung-min: The Pride of Tottenham
Now, let's talk about the main man – Son Heung-min! This guy is an absolute legend, right? For those who may be new, Son is a South Korean professional footballer who plays as a forward for Tottenham Hotspur in the Premier League, and captains the South Korea national team. He's renowned for his incredible speed, his lethal finishing, his two-footedness (seriously, how many players can strike so well with both feet?), and his infectious smile. He's not just a footballer; he's a global icon, a role model, and an all-around awesome human being. Son isn't merely a player; he is a phenomenon.

Premier League Coverage: What to Expect
The Premier League is the top of the English football league system, contested by 20 clubs, it operates on a system of promotion and relegation with the English Football League (EFL). Seasons run from August to May with teams playing 38 matches each. It is the most-watched football league in the world, broadcast in 212 territories to 643 million homes and a potential TV audience of 4.7 billion people.
